Normally we recommend Z275 (zinc coating of 275 grams/sqm). The structure is concealed and the possibility of it having been exposed to air and humidity is minimal and despite it having high zinc coating it will prevent it from rusting for years. However, the structure should be free from water leaks.

Material cost would not be so far however the conventional method is more prone to error, re-works and imperfections. For CFS, the main savings would be on the manpower cost as you can save as much as 50%.
Depending on the finishing and complexity of the design, a standard two storey structure should be ready for occupancy in a matter of 45-60 days compared to conventional being 6-8 months or even a year.

If the location is within the parameters of a coastal area and the air is salty, we recommend using a higher zinc coating, most likely at least Z300 but Z275 will do it.
